Turkish steel billet prices have fallen sharply in all markets over the past week because of the recent downturn in ferrous scrap import values, sources said on Thursday February 6.
Fastmarkets' daily index for steel scrap, HMS 1&2 (80:20 mix), US origin, cfr Turkey, was $259.76 per tonne on Thursday, down from $272.52 per tonne a week before.Billet suppliers in the Commonwealth of Independent States (CIS) region have reduced their offers for Turkey to $400-410 per tonne cfr.
